Meet Playwrite Danmark Loopet: a modern digital font designed for teaching Danish cursive.

Playwrite Danmark Loopet, meticulously engineered by Veronika Burian and José Scaglione of TypeTogether, represents a sophisticated synthesis of pedagogical tradition and modern variable font technology, specifically calibrated to meet the cursive literacy standards of the Danish primary education system. By utilizing a singular interpolation axis, the typeface preserves the integrity of its characteristic looped ductus while offering fluid weight transitions that accommodate diverse digital environments without compromising the anatomical precision required for early childhood handwriting instruction. This typeface functions as a critical component of a global typographic initiative, leveraging advanced OpenType mapping to simulate the rhythmic flow of manual script, thereby transforming static glyphs into a dynamic educational tool that honors regional handwriting heritage through the lens of contemporary type design.

Playwrite Danmark Loopet Font Frequently Asked Questions

What are the primary visual characteristics of the Playwrite Danmark Loopet style?

Playwrite Danmark Loopet is characterized by its fluid, cursive handwriting style featuring distinctive loops on ascenders and descenders. The typeface adheres to the Danish educational standard for penmanship, utilizing a specific slant angle and rhythmic stroke modulation to emulate authentic handwriting.

How does the looped design impact vertical spacing in a layout?

The pronounced loops require increased line height to prevent overlapping between the descenders of one line and the ascenders of the next. Technical analysis of the font's bounding box reveals a high vertical metrics ratio, necessitating a generous leading value to maintain optical clarity.

How does the legibility of the loops perform at small point sizes?

At smaller point sizes, the intricate loops can become cluttered, reducing the overall legibility of the text. Sub-pixel rendering challenges at sizes below 12px often cause the delicate counters of the loops to collapse, resulting in a loss of character definition.

Does the character set include regional glyphs for Nordic languages?

As a font specifically designed for the Danish market, it includes a comprehensive set of glyphs and diacritics for Nordic languages. The character map fully supports the Unicode Latin Extended-A range, ensuring that specific Nordic characters like 'æ', 'ø', and 'å' maintain stylistic consistency with the looped script.
